Side-by-Side Comparison

Feature blagues blogue
Definition Pluriel de blague. Site Web, ou partie de site Web, personnel dans lequel l’auteur note, au fur et à mesure de sa réflexion sur un sujet qui lui importe, des avis, impressions, etc., pour les diffuser et susciter des réactions, commentaires et discussions, et dont les articles ou contribution individuels sont connus comme billets.
